"Night Sky Stories Over a Summer Campfire"
  • Date: Tuesday, May 27th, 20142014-05-27
  • Time: 7:00pm
  • Location: Hardin PlanetariumHardin Planetarium
Description:

Summer, more than any other season of the year, is a time for star-gazing.  Whether you are lucky enough to observe from a rural setting or find yourself looking skyward from a brightly lit town, this show is designed to help you become more familiar with the star patterns visible in the summer evenings. Share with us the glory of the celestial sphere as we look for ways to help identify them and remember the patterns they make.

This show is suitable for all ages and airs every Tuesday and Thursday nights at 7 pm and Sunday at 2 pm.
